What is data backup?

The term data backup is known to be a term that entails the act of copying of physical or virtual files or databases to nay kind of secondary location for safe keep or preservation.

In any organization, the backing up of system files as well as documents and organisation information are very important in terms of system failure or breakdown.

While there are hundreds of different operating systems, there are only three basic categories, which are... Option 1: Proprietary, open-source, and embedded Option 2: Windows, macOS, and Linux Option 3: Mobile, desktop, and server Option 4: Unix, Linux, and Android

Answers

Answer:

1: Proprietary, open-source, and embedded

Explanation:

To begin with, 'Windows, macOS and Linux' aren't categories. They're names (and also specific examples of operating systems). Technically Option 3 is also correct, but it's not as 'technical' as Option 1. Option 4 is just completely wrong, Linux is based off of Unix, and Android is based off of Linux. Again, those aren't categories.

Now onto the full explanation:

Windows is an operating system made by Microsoft, macOS is made by Apple, and Linux was originally created by Linus Torvalds.

A good tie-in between the explanation of Option 1 and 2 is that, Windows and MacOS are proprietary (owned by a person or company, the code is not publicly shared), and Linux is open-source (the general public can contribute code, albeit within reason).

Embedded operating systems aren't common-place in commercial desktop computers, but in offices generally there are plenty of them. Coffee machines run on embedded operating systems (although a fair few actually run off Linux surprisingly), printers run on embedded operating systems, and essentially the Internet of Things as a collective run on embedded operating systems.
